Korean[edit]

Etymology[edit]

Sino-Korean word from 舌癌, from (tongue) + (cancer).

Pronunciation[edit]

Romanizations
Revised Romanization?seoram
Revised Romanization (translit.)?seol'am
McCune–Reischauer?sŏram
Yale Romanization?sel.am

Noun[edit]

설암 (seoram) (hanja 舌癌)

  1. (pathology) oral cancer; mouth cancer
